Written for the professional who has an immediate need for the
information but has little or no training in the subject, Cleanroom
Microbiology for the Non-Microbiologist, Second Edition introduces
principles of microbiology. It explains the consequences of
microbiological contamination, what contamination is all about, how
microorganisms grow, and how they can be controlled. The author
introduces the vocabulary of microbiology and the types, sources,
control, and elimination of organisms encountered in the
manufacture of sterile products. Beginning with a discussion of the
various types of organisms, the text then covers applications for
bacterial detection, avoidance of contamination, cleanroom design
considerations, and validation of disinfection methods. New topics
covered include: -International cleanroom standards -Application of
rapid, automated methods for detecting and identifying microbial
contaminants -In-depth examination of the role of biofilms in pure
water systems -Increased coverage of production of therapeutic
products derived from live tissues and cells
